| CVE-2026-19693 | 1 Max-mapper | 1 Extract-zip | 2026-08-17 | 8.1 High |
| extract-zip through 2.0.1 containment-checks only the parent directory of each archive entry and never the entry's own final path component, so an archive containing two entries with identical names - a symlink whose target is outside the destination, followed by a regular file - writes through the planted symlink and yields an arbitrary file write outside the destination directory. | ||||
| CVE-2026-16099 | 2 Eric Teubert, Wordpress | 2 Podlove Podcast Publisher, Wordpress | 2026-08-17 | 8.8 High |
| The Podlove Podcast Publisher plugin for WordPress is vulnerable to arbitrary file deletion due to insufficient file path validation in the create_link_item function in all versions up to, and including, 4.5.3. This makes it possible for authenticated attackers, with contributor-level access and above, to delete arbitrary files on the server, which can easily lead to remote code execution when the right file is deleted (such as wp-config.php). A viable POP chain exists within the plugin itself via Podlove\ImageCache\GenerationGuard, whose __destruct() method invokes wp_delete_file() with an attacker-controlled file path populated through unserialization. | ||||
| CVE-2026-10035 | 2 Wordpress, Wpweaver | 2 Wordpress, Turnkey Bbpress By Weavertheme | 2026-08-17 | 6.6 Medium |
| The Turnkey bbPress by WeaverTheme plugin for WordPress is vulnerable to PHP Object Injection in all versions up to, and including, 1.7.1 via deserialization of untrusted input in the wvrbbp_set_to_serialized_values() function (reached through the wvrbbp_save_restore() settings-restore handler). The function reads the raw contents of an administrator-uploaded file and passes them directly to unserialize() without any validation. This makes it possible for authenticated attackers, with administrator-level access and above, to inject a PHP Object. No known POP chain is present in the vulnerable plugin itself; however, if a POP chain is present via an additional plugin or theme installed on the target system, it could allow the attacker to delete arbitrary files, retrieve sensitive data, or execute code. | ||||

| CVE-2026-73533 | 2 Wordpress, Wpmanageninja | 2 Wordpress, Ninja Tables | 2026-08-17 | 9.8 Critical |
| Ninja Tables Pro 5.2.11 contains an embedded malicious code vulnerability introduced via a tampered plugin build served through a decommissioned update server. The tampered build introduced a rogue PHP file (app/Library/updater/NinjaTableDataSync.php) that established a backdoor REST API endpoint, dropped persistent PHP files in mu-plugins and uploads directories, installed a passwordless administrator account, and registered scheduled tasks that survived plugin removal. | ||||

| CVE-2026-74354 | 1 Linux | 1 Linux Kernel | 2026-08-17 | 7.8 High |
| In the Linux kernel, the following vulnerability has been resolved: bpf: Take mmap_lock in zap_pages() zap_vma_range() requires the owning mm's mmap_lock to be held. Taking mmap_read_lock under arena->lock would AB-BA against arena_vm_close() and arena_map_mmap(), both of which run with mmap_write_lock held and then acquire arena->lock. Instead drop arena->lock, mmget_not_zero() the vma's mm, take mmap_read_lock, and re-resolve the vma via find_vma() since it may have been unmapped or replaced while waiting. Track processed vmls with a per-call generation in vml->zap_gen and serialize zap_pages() callers with a new arena->zap_mutex so concurrent callers on different uaddr ranges do not mark each other's vmls processed before the zap is done. | ||||
| CVE-2026-74364 | 1 Linux | 1 Linux Kernel | 2026-08-17 | 7.1 High |
| In the Linux kernel, the following vulnerability has been resolved: bpf: Reject exclusive maps as inner maps in map-in-map An exclusive map (created with excl_prog_hash) is bound to a single program by hash: check_map_prog_compatibility() refuses to load any program whose digest does not match map->excl_prog_sha. That check only runs for maps a program references directly, i.e. its used_maps. A map reached at runtime through a map-of-maps is never in used_maps, and bpf_map_meta_equal() does not consider excl_prog_sha, so an exclusive map can be inserted into a non-exclusive outer map and then looked up and mutated by an unrelated program, bypassing the exclusivity guarantee. For the signed loader this defeats the metadata map exclusivity check added in the signed loader: the cached map->sha[] is validated against the signed hash while another program on a hostile host rewrites the frozen map's contents through the outer map. | ||||

| CVE-2025-48938 | 1 Cli | 1 Go-gh | 2026-08-17 | 9.8 Critical |
| go-gh is a collection of Go modules to make authoring GitHub CLI extensions easier. A security vulnerability has been identified in versions prior to 2.12.1 where an attacker-controlled GitHub Enterprise Server could result in executing arbitrary commands on a user's machine by replacing HTTP URLs provided by GitHub with local file paths for browsing. In `2.12.1`, `Browser.Browse()` has been enhanced to allow and disallow a variety of scenarios to avoid opening or executing files on the filesystem without unduly impacting HTTP URLs. No known workarounds are available other than upgrading. | ||||

| CVE-2026-72314 | 1 Linux | 1 Linux Kernel | 2026-08-17 | 7.8 High |
| In the Linux kernel, the following vulnerability has been resolved: regulator: core: regulator_lock_two() should test for EDEADLK not EDEADLOCK Compare against -EDEADLK, which is what ww_mutex_lock() actually returns and what every other deadlock check in this file already uses. Function regulator_lock_two() acquires two regulators via regulator_lock_nested() -> ww_mutex_lock(). On contention, ww_mutex_lock() returns -EDEADLK, which is the caller's signal to drop the lock it holds and retry the acquisition in the canonical order. However, regulator_lock_two() tests the return value against -EDEADLOCK rather than -EDEADLK. On most architectures, EDEADLK and EDEADLOCK are the same value, so the comparison happens to be correct and the bug is invisible. But on MIPS, SPARC, and PowerPC, those two errors have different values. The test is wrong: a genuine -EDEADLK backoff no longer matches -EDEADLOCK, so instead of unlocking and retrying, the code falls into WARN_ON(ret) and returns with only one of the two regulators locked. In practice, this is a bug only on MIPS, because the regulator core is not built or used on the other two platforms. In general, EDEADLK is preferred over EDEADLOCK for new code. | ||||
| CVE-2026-72031 | 1 Linux | 1 Linux Kernel | 2026-08-17 | 5.5 Medium |
| In the Linux kernel, the following vulnerability has been resolved: ata: libata-core: Add NOLPM quirk for PNY CS900 1TB SSD The PNY CS900 1TB SSD (Phison PS3111-S11, DRAM-less) drops off the bus after entering Device-Initiated Slumber during idle. With the default med_power_with_dipm policy the link goes down (SStatus 1 SControl 300) and does not recover, forcing the filesystem read-only. Forcing max_performance keeps the link stable across prolonged idle. Add a NOLPM quirk so link power management is disabled for this drive specifically, leaving it intact for other devices on the host. | ||||

| CVE-2026-53784 | 2 Rsync Project, Samba | 2 Rsync, Rsync | 2026-08-15 | 7.1 High |
| rsync before 3.5.0 contains a path traversal vulnerability that allows remote clients to access files outside the intended module root when use chroot is disabled and the module root path or a component of it is a symlink. The daemon calls chdir() to the module root at session initialization without resolving symlinks via realpath() or equivalent, causing subsequent relative-path operations to reference files relative to the symlink target rather than the intended module root, enabling unauthorized file access. | ||||
| CVE-2026-73499 | 1 Etcd | 1 Etcd | 2026-08-14 | 6.5 Medium |
| etcd is a distributed key-value store for the data of a distributed system. Prior to versions 3.5.33, 3.6.14, and 3.7.1, a user granted READ permission on a single exact key can use the Watch gRPC API with clientv3.WithFromKey() to receive watch events for every key lexicographically greater than or equal to the permitted key. In server/etcdserver/api/v3rpc/watch.go, the open-ended RangeEnd sentinel is rewritten before the RBAC permission check in server/auth/range_perm_cache.go function isRangeOpPermitted, causing the request to be treated as an exact-key watch. Range/Get and DeleteRange requests are not affected, and the issue affects only clusters with authentication enabled. This issue is fixed in versions 3.5.33, 3.6.14, and 3.7.1. | ||||
